Transaction 8010c86ee89dbcf14dcfbda7483bb240f55a064567f86e0cb0b83387b18d8622
1 Input
1 Output
-
8010c86ee89dbcf14dcfbda7483bb240f55a064567f86e0cb0b83387b18d8622:0
- value
- 15273527
- script pubkey
- OP_0 OP_PUSHBYTES_20 e2f987b6a0f539fcdb965e41aa46607547b2232d
- address
- bc1qutuc0d4q75ulekukteq653nqw4rmygedlmrv60